package io
import (
"bytes"
"context"
"errors"
"image"
"io"
"log"
"sync"
"sync/atomic"
"time"
"github.com/gabstv/primen/dom"
)
type Container interface {
Len() int64
FS() Filesystem
Load(name string) chan struct{}
Unload(name string) (bool, error)
LoadAll(names []string) (progress chan float64, done chan struct{})
UnloadAll()
Get(name string) ([]byte, error)
GetImage(name string) (image.Image, error)
GetAtlas(name string) (*Atlas, error)
GetAudioStream(name string) (*AudioStream, error)
GetAudioBytes(name string) ([]byte, error)
GetXMLDOM(name string) ([]dom.Node, error)
}
type container struct {
ctx context.Context
fs Filesystem
m sync.RWMutex
loadedfiles map[string][]byte
loadingfiles map[string]chan struct{}
loadedlen int64 // atomic
loadinglen int64 // atomic
loadingn int32 // atomic
audiostreams []*AudioStream
}
func (c *container) Len() int64 {
return atomic.LoadInt64(&c.loadedlen)
}
func (c *container) FS() Filesystem {
return c.fs
}
func (c *container) Load(name string) chan struct{} {
c.m.RLock()
xch, ok := c.loadingfiles[name]
c.m.RUnlock()
if ok {
// already loading/loaded
return xch
}
atomic.AddInt32(&c.loadingn, 1)
ldch := make(chan struct{}, 1)
go func() {
defer close(ldch)
c.m.Lock()
c.loadingfiles[name] = ldch
c.m.Unlock()
defer atomic.AddInt32(&c.loadingn, -1)
f, err := c.fs.Open(name)
if err != nil {
log.Println("container io error: " + err.Error())
return
}
defer f.Close()
fi, err := f.Stat()
if err != nil {
log.Println("container stat error: " + err.Error())
return
}
atomic.AddInt64(&c.loadinglen, fi.Size())
defer atomic.AddInt64(&c.loadinglen, -fi.Size())
buf := new(bytes.Buffer)
buf.Grow(int(fi.Size()))
if _, err := buf.ReadFrom(f); err != nil {
log.Println("container io error: " + err.Error())
return
}
c.m.Lock()
c.loadedfiles[name] = buf.Bytes()
c.m.Unlock()
atomic.AddInt64(&c.loadedlen, int64(buf.Len()))
}()
return ldch
}
func (c *container) Unload(name string) (bool, error) {
c.m.RLock()
loadingch, ok := c.loadingfiles[name]
c.m.RUnlock()
if !ok {
return false, nil
}
select {
case <-time.After(time.Microsecond * 500):
return false, errors.New("resource is loading")
case <-loadingch:
}
c.m.Lock()
delete(c.loadingfiles, name)
x := len(c.loadedfiles[name])
delete(c.loadedfiles, name)
c.m.Unlock()
atomic.AddInt64(&c.loadedlen, int64(x))
return true, nil
}
func (c *container) LoadAll(names []string) (progress chan float64, done chan struct{}) {
progress = make(chan float64, 64)
done = make(chan struct{})
if len(names) < 1 {
close(done)
return
}
go func() {
defer close(done)
defer func() {
select {
case <-c.ctx.Done():
case <-time.After(time.Second):
}
close(progress)
}()
var step float64 = 1 / float64(len(names))
var current float64
for _, name := range names {
done1 := c.Load(name)
select {
case <-c.ctx.Done():
return
case <-done1:
}
current += step
progress <- current
}
}()
return
}
func (c *container) UnloadAll() {
c.m.RLock()
names := make([]string, 0, len(c.loadingfiles))
for name, _ := range c.loadingfiles {
names = append(names, name)
}
c.m.RUnlock()
for _, name := range names {
_, _ = c.Unload(name)
}
}
func (c *container) Get(name string) ([]byte, error) {
c.m.RLock()
fd, ok := c.loadedfiles[name]
c.m.RUnlock()
if ok {
return fd, nil
}
c.m.RLock()
fch, ok := c.loadingfiles[name]
c.m.RUnlock()
if ok {
<-fch
c.m.RLock()
fd = c.loadedfiles[name]
c.m.RUnlock()
if fd == nil {
return nil, errors.New("x not found")
}
return fd, nil
}
// check if exists
if _, err := c.fs.Stat(name);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
ch := c.Load(name)
<-ch
c.m.RLock()
fd = c.loadedfiles[name]
c.m.RUnlock()
if fd == nil {
return nil, errors.New("x not found")
}
return fd, nil
}
func (c *container) GetImage(name string) (image.Image, error) {
b, err := c.Get(name)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
img, _, err := image.Decode(bytes.NewReader(b))
return img, err
}
func (c *container) GetAtlas(name string) (*Atlas, error) {
b, err := c.Get(name)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return ParseAtlas(b)
}
func (c *container) GetAudioStream(name string) (*AudioStream, error) {
b, err := c.Get(name)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return ParseAudioStream(name, b)
}
func (c *container) GetAudioBytes(name string) ([]byte, error) {
b, err := c.Get(name)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
stream, err := ParseAudioStream(name, b)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
buf := new(bytes.Buffer)
io.Copy(buf, stream.Data)
return buf.Bytes(), nil
}
func (c *container) GetXMLDOM(name string) ([]dom.Node, error) {
b, err := c.Get(name)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return dom.ParseXMLString(string(b))
}
func NewContainer(ctx context.Context, fs Filesystem) Container {
c := &container{
ctx: ctx,
fs: fs,
loadedfiles: make(map[string][]byte),
loadingfiles: make(map[string]chan struct{}),
}
return c
}
